Demand for paid Android sat-nav app continues to rise despite free navigation tools

CoPilot Live, the leading sat-nav app has reported an overall 40% year on year rise in sales of its Android app (Q4 2011 vs Q4 2010). With a record 1.2bn app downloads over Christmas, and Google recently announcing over 250 million Android devices have now been activated – the Android app market is clearly booming, and [...]

Headline: How long is your commute?

A recent study by the US Census Bureau provides a revealing insight into how people get to work – and how long it takes them. Unsurprisingly, the report shows that the most popular method of commuting in the U.S. is by car – 86% – with an average journey time of 25 minutes – a 10% [...]
